The Amplim Heartbeat Soother is designed with a simple yet effective purpose: to replicate the calming sound of a mother’s heartbeat. Research suggests that babies tend to fall asleep faster when they hear this familiar, rhythmic sound. Beyond just the heartbeat, this device offers 19 additional calming sounds, such as ocean waves, rain, and white noise, aimed at soothing the user into a restful state. It features a rechargeable battery, adjustable volume settings, and a timer function. Its compact size makes it an ideal travel companion, whether you’re heading to a hotel or simply taking a walk.
In real-world testing, I found the setup to be incredibly straightforward. The machine is ready to use right out of the box, with easy-to-navigate buttons for adjusting the sound, volume, and timer. Whether it was during a car ride, at home in the nursery, or even in a hotel room, the soother performed as expected. The sound quality is clear, and the heartbeat sound was particularly comforting for my baby. I especially appreciated the portability factor, as I was able to easily hang it on the stroller or keep it in my bag without hassle. That said, the sound may not be loud enough for very noisy environments, so it’s important to keep that in mind if you’re in a particularly loud setting.
Now, let’s talk pros and cons. The biggest strengths of this product are its portability and the soothing effect it can have on babies, as well as adults seeking a good night’s sleep. The variety of sounds is a nice touch, offering versatility beyond just the heartbeat sound. The compact design is also a huge plus for parents on the go. However, the volume levels, while adjustable, may not be sufficient for some environments, and the battery life could be longer given its portable nature.
When it comes to value for money, this soother is a solid investment. While it’s priced on the higher end for a white noise machine, the inclusion of the heartbeat recording and the portability features give it a unique edge. The quality feels premium, and the 365-day warranty provides peace of mind. Still, you can find similar devices at a lower price, though they might lack the heartbeat feature or not be as compact.
Comparing this to other white noise machines on the market, many offer basic white noise and sound options, but few provide the personalized touch of a recorded heartbeat. Many other machines also lack the same portability and rechargeable battery. If you’re willing to spend a little extra, the Amplim Soother stands out with these premium features.
As for build quality, the device feels sturdy despite its compact size, and the materials used are durable. It’s built to last, and even though we’ve only had it for a short period, there’s no indication that the product will degrade over time. If you’re planning on frequent travel, it should hold up well.
Customer support for Amplim is highly regarded, with the company offering a 365-day warranty and responsive support. This ensures that if you do encounter any issues, you have recourse to get them resolved.
In terms of product alternatives, if you’re looking for a cheaper option, there are white noise machines available that offer similar sound profiles. However, they won’t have the heartbeat feature or the same level of portability, making this a standout option for those specifically looking for these unique features.
To sum up, the Amplim Record Mom’s Heartbeat Soother is a strong option for parents looking to soothe their babies with a calming, familiar sound. Its portability, variety of sounds, and sturdy design make it a valuable addition to any nursery or travel kit. However, the volume levels and battery life could be better.
